**14:22** — Confirmed the Orrel API's cursor pagination broke after the index migration: cursors minted before the deploy resolved to shifted offsets, so clients saw duplicated and skipped records on page boundaries. Rolled the read path back to the prior index and invalidated stale cursors. Duplicate rate returned to zero within ten minutes. The rollback artifact's token is captured below.

trace token, fafof-tajef: htk9_849b0fd88

Subject: Prototype run to Caldrix Labs

Hi dispatch team,

Quick one for the records: we're sending the two Veylon M3 prototype boards over to Caldrix Labs in Harwick Vale for thermal testing this Thursday. They're packed in the grey anti-static cases, labelled and signed out by Priya from the bench team. Nothing fancy needed on the paperwork, just log it as outbound engineering stock as usual.

One thing though — these are pre-release units, so the courier hand-over needs to follow the confidential instruction below.

dispatch memo: the lamwyn fenwyn courier leaves the wenir ledger at gate 7175 under passcode 822969

As part of our quarterly security cycle, the stale-branch cleanup bot now signs all automated deletion commits with a rotated deploy credential. Support impact: customers who verify bot commits against the old key will see verification failures starting next Monday; please direct them to the updated docs and confirm their mirrors have synced. No change to branch-age thresholds or notification cadence. The previous key is revoked effective immediately. For reference during support calls, the new signing key follows.

signing key of bagap-yawep = bky13_TbfT6ZMUoGJo2

Handover Note — Marketing Budget Reduction

From: D. Crellow, outgoing Director of Commercial
To: M. Varnish, incoming Director of Commercial

For the finance team's reference: the marketing budget for Quellon Foods has been cut by 22% effective next quarter. The Brightmere campaign is paused; retainers with Auldwick Creative end this month. Remaining spend covers the Lanner Bay trade fair and digital placements only. Accruals are reconciled through period nine. Please note the strategic context below before approving further commitments.

confidential, kagup-bafog: Fraaxax Group is in early talks to buy Soroxox Group for about $343.8 million. The Olidor launch date is June 14, and nothing goes to the press before then. Legal wants the Aldmirek Logistics term sheet signed before July 23.